1 : Visit the Pink Palace [2 hrs]
The Pink Palace, also known as Ahsan Manzil, is a stunning historical building located on the banks of the Buriganga River. It was the official residential palace and seat of the Nawab of Dhaka during the British rule. Explore the unique architecture, beautiful gardens, and learn about the history of the Nawabs of Bengal.

Background Info
Weather
Dhaka experiences a tropical monsoon climate with warm temperatures throughout the year. Average temperatures range from 23°C to 34°C. The city receives heavy rainfall during the monsoon season from June to September, with high humidity levels. Air quality can be a concern, especially in the dry season.
Language
Bengali is the official language of Bangladesh. English is widely spoken and understood in urban areas like Dhaka, including Gulshan.
